Pair Of 18th-century Corinthian Capitals Forming A Saddle

Very attractive pair of Corinthian capitals in oak forming a saddle.
The two capitals are attached with two easily removable screwed fasteners.
Very fine carving and attractive natural patina.
Some missing parts to note.
Dimensions :H 57cm L 32cm
